MPs have called for a smooth and swift passage through parliament for the proposed private members Bill on stalking. At a conference on 18 October organised by the Suzy Lamplugh Trust, Home Office Minister David Maclean MP announced the measures to be included in the Government-backed bill. He said a twin-track approach combining criminal sanctions with a civil remedy would remain at the heart of the proposals. On the criminal side, a high-level offence for the most serious cases and a lower level offence for non-violent threats would be introduced.
